Adelsheim (pronounced Addels-Heim) was founded in 1971 by David and Ginny Adelsheim with one pursuit: to create world-class wines in the undiscovered wine region that would later become Chehalem Mountains AVA, a venerable subregion of Oregon's famous Willamette Valley. Established in 1971, Adelsheim is a family-owned and operated winery with estate vineyards located in Oregon's northern Willamette Valley. The Chehalem Mountains is a northwest-southeast span of several distinct mountains, ridges and peaks in the northern part of the Willamette Valley. The region covers 70,000 acres but only 1,600 acres are planted to vines; soils of the Chehalem Mountains are a mix of basalt, ocean sediment and loess. Willamette Valley and Chehalem Mountains pioneer David Adelsheim first experienced site- and clone-specific Chardonnay in Burgundy, France, in 1974. Over the years, he brought those same Chardonnay clones to the Chehalem Mountains to stake claim and bring his vision to life. Chehalem Mountains is a AVA (American Viticultural Area) of the larger Willamette Valley wine region in the US state of Oregon.
